Le Pennsylvania Department of Transportation est un département d'État dédié au transport. Il ne s'agit pas d'un emplacement du DMV (Department of Motor Vehicles). Leur adresse est la suivante : Keystone Building, 400 North St, Harrisburg, PA 17120. Leur numéro de téléphone est le 174125300.

Ce département est spécialisé dans le transport au niveau de l'État. Il offre des services tels que l'entretien des routes, la sécurité routière, les permis de conduire et l'immatriculation des véhicules. Leur site web est , où vous pouvez trouver plus d'informations sur les services qu'ils offrent.

L'emplacement du Pennsylvania Department of Transportation est accessible en fauteuil roulant et dispose d'un parking accessible en fauteuil roulant.
